Level 2 Cache Size

Some systems have a specific setting you must change to indicate how much level 2 cache you have on your board. Most newer boards do not have this setting and instead the hardware automatically detects how much level 2 cache you have. If you have this setting in your setup program, make sure it is correct.

Note: This setting will not be present on Pentium Pro or Pentium II motherboards, since these chips use integrated level 2 cache, not cache on the motherboard.
